Saturn in Infrared from Cassini
Image Credit: NASA, JPL-Caltech, SSI; Processing: Maksim Kakitsev
Explanation: Saturn looks slightly different in infrared light. Bands
of clouds show great structure, including long stretching storms. Also
quite striking in infrared is the unusual hexagonal cloud pattern
surrounding Saturn's North Pole. Each side of the dark hexagon spans
roughly the width of our Earth. The hexagon's existence was not
predicted, and its origin and likely stability remain a topics of
research. Saturn's famous rings circle the planet and cast shadows
below the equator. The featured image was taken by the robotic Cassini
spacecraft in 2014 in several infrared colors. In 2017 September, the
Cassini mission was brought to a dramatic conclusion when the
spacecraft was directed to dive into the ringed giant.
